Witness the Training: Open Workouts

Open workouts are a fantastic opportunity to see the fighters in action before the main event. Typically held a few days before the fight, these sessions offer a glimpse into the training routines of some of the athletes competing on the card. While the fighters aren’t necessarily sparring or going all-out, you can expect to see them working on their striking, grappling, and conditioning. The specific date, time, and location will be announced by the UFC closer to the event, so keep an eye on their official channels.

Expected fighters attending usually include the main event competitors, as well as some of the other notable names on the card. This is a chance to witness their focus, discipline, and physical prowess up close. Expect training demonstrations, shadow boxing, pad work, and perhaps even some brief Q&A sessions with the fighters, depending on the event’s format. Looking back at past UFC events, open workouts often include demonstrations of signature moves and insights into the fighters’ game plans. Arrive early to secure a good viewing spot, as these events can get crowded.

The Staredown: Official Weigh-Ins

The weigh-ins are arguably the most intense and dramatic of the public events. This is where the fighters officially step on the scales to ensure they’ve met the weight requirements for their respective weight classes. But it’s much more than just a formality. The weigh-ins are often a stage for intense staredowns, trash talk, and psychological warfare. The tension in the air is palpable, and the energy of the crowd adds to the drama.

The date, time, and location of the weigh-ins will be announced by the UFC. This event is crucial for ensuring the fights can proceed as scheduled, and it provides a crucial look at the physical condition of the fighters before they enter the octagon. The potential for intense face-offs and verbal sparring is a major draw for fans, and the weigh-ins offer a unique opportunity to witness the raw emotion and competitive spirit of the athletes. There are often opportunities for fan interaction, such as cheering for your favorite fighters and participating in chants. Be prepared for a loud and energetic atmosphere.

Meet Your Heroes: Fan Q and A and Meet and Greets

Many UFC events include fan Q and A sessions or meet and greets with UFC personalities. These provide a golden opportunity to get up close and personal with fighters, analysts, and other figures from the world of mixed martial arts. While not always guaranteed, these events are often a highlight for fans. Check the official UFC schedule closer to the event to see if any are planned for UFC 310.

Confirmed UFC personalities attending can vary, but often include retired fighters, commentators, analysts, and even active fighters not competing on the current card. This is your chance to ask questions, get autographs, and take photos with your favorite personalities. Preparation is key. Think about what you want to ask beforehand and be respectful of their time. Showing your support and expressing your appreciation can make a real difference to the athletes.

Maximizing Your Experience: Tips for Attending

Plan Ahead: Preparing for the Event

Arriving early is crucial to secure a good spot at popular events like weigh-ins and open workouts. Check the official UFC website or social media channels for updates on the schedule and any potential changes. Consider transportation and parking options in advance, as these events can attract large crowds and parking may be limited.

Show Respect: Event Etiquette

Be respectful of fighters, other fans, and event staff. Follow instructions from event staff and security personnel. Avoid disruptive behavior that could detract from the experience of others. Remember that you are representing the UFC community.

Be Prepared: What to Bring

Bring a camera or phone for photos and videos. A sharpie is essential for getting autographs. Wear comfortable shoes, as you may be standing for extended periods. Bring water to stay hydrated, especially if the event is outdoors. Small bags are generally allowed, but be sure to check the event’s specific regulations beforehand.
